Abstract

An output driver circuit includes a push-pull driver for driving an output signal of a semiconductor device to one of two voltage levels corresponding to a determined data state. The push-pull driver includes a pull-up driving circuit for driving the output signal toward a first voltage level when the data state is logic “high,” and a pull-down driving circuit for driving the output signal to a second voltage level when the data state is “low.” The strength with which the pull-up driving circuit drives the voltage level of the output signal toward the first output voltage level can be controlled independently of the strength with which the pull-down driving circuit drives the voltage level of the output signal toward the second output voltage level. The rate at which the pull-up driving circuit drives the output signal voltage level from a “low” data state to a “high” data state can also be controlled independently of the rate at which the pull-down driving circuit drives the output signal voltage level from the “high” data state to the “low” data state.
